WebCurrent accounts of the Ebbinghaus illusion emphasize either size contrast or contour interaction processes. To assess these alternatives, four variants of the Ebbinghaus figure were constructed using 1, 5, 9, or 13 small circles dispersed along the perimeter of larger contextual circles. 30 observers ranked the perceived size of the central circles and a … WebHeinz-Dieter Ebbinghaus is Professor Emeritus at the Mathematical Institute of the University of Freiburg. WebSep 7, 2024 · This paper analyzes the savings measures introduced by Ebbinghaus in his monograph of 1885. He measured memory retention in terms of the learning time saved in subsequent study trials relative to the time spent on the first learning trial. He was the son of Carl Ebbinghaus, a merchant in the town of Barmen near Bonn, Germany. Of his infancy and childhood it is known only that he was brought up in the Lutheran faith and was a pupil at the town Gymnasium until he was 17. gold with marthaWebJan 25, 2024 · Herman Ebbinghaus was a psychologist who, in 1885, applied the scientific method to study how people learn, remember, and forget.
